+ Vận dụng những kiến thức kỹ năng đã học vào giải các bài tập đúng, chính xác.. + Học sinh yêu thích giải bài toán trong lĩnh vực tin học.[r]
(1)Ngày soạn: 21/02/2010 Ngày dạy: 24/02/2010 Tiết: 35 BÀI TẬP I.Mục đích: + Củng cố lại kiến thức đã học + Vận dụng kiến thức kỹ đã học vào giải các bài tập đúng, chính xác + Học sinh yêu thích giải bài toán lĩnh vực tin học II.Biện pháp: Dạy và học phát và giải vấn đề III Phương tiện: - GV: Sách bài tập và số bài tập nâng cao - HS: SGK, bút vở, nháp… IV Nội dung tiết dạy: Ổn định tổ chức: Tiến trình bài học: Hoạt động Nội dung A./ Lý thuyết Gv:Yêu cầu học sinh lên bảng nêu ? Nêu khái niệm, viết khai báo liệu kiểu khái niệm và viết khai báo ghi B./ B ài t ập - HS: Lên bảng viết khai báo Bài 8: GV: Nhận xét cho điểm Chương tr ình sau thực gì? Program BT8; GV: Chia học sinh thành nhóm Const Nmax = 50; giao bài Type Mass = array [1 Nmax-1] of real; Var A: Mass; - Yêu cầu học sinh chạy thử chương I, j, N: Byte; C:real; trình Begin - Cho hs chạy thử chương trình trên Write(‘Nhap N = ’); readln(N); với Input khác For i:=1 to N Lop11.com (2) For J:=0 to N-1 ? Cho biết chương trình trên thực Begin công việc gì Write (‘A[‘,i,’,’,j,’] = ‘); readln (A[i,j]); End; HS: Làm theo yêu cầu GV For i:=1 to N For J:=0 to N-1 Begin C:=A[i,j]; A[i,j]:= A[N-i+1,j]; A[N-i+1,j]:=C; End; For i:=1 to N Begin For j:=0 to N-1 write(A[i,j]:5:2,’ ‘); Writeln; End; Readln End Củng cố: Nhắc lại câu lệnh lặp với số lần chưa biết trước và lặp với số lần biết trước Dặn dò: Về nhà học bài và l àm tiếp các bài tập SGK trang 79 Lop11.com (3)